Article - Emissions scandal: “The key is to make the rules as robust as possible”

jeu, 09/02/2017 - 16:02
General : The Volkswagen scandal - involving the manipulation of emission tests - exposed the weakness of the current EU car certification system. On Thursday the internal market committee adopted proposals aimed at making this more difficult, including checks on cars already in circulation. The proposals will now need to be approved by all MEPs during an upcoming plenary session. We talked to UK ECR member Daniel Dalton, the MEP in charge of steering these plans through Parliament.

Press release - EU job-search aid: €1.8m for 800 former retail workers in the Netherlands - Committee on Budgets

jeu, 09/02/2017 - 09:42
EU job search aid worth €1,818,750 for 800 former retail workers in the Netherlands was approved by the Budgets Committee in a vote on Thursday. The workers were made redundant by six retail trade companies which recently went bankrupt in the Drenthe and Overijssel regions. The European Globalisation Adjustment Fund (EGF) aid still needs to be approved by Parliament as a whole, on 14 February and by the Council of Ministers, on 17 February.

Press release - Georgia visa waiver approved by Parliament

jeu, 02/02/2017 - 12:09
Plenary sessions : Georgian citizens will be able to enter the EU without a visa for short stays, under a new law passed by Parliament on Thursday.

Press release - MEPs call for automatic cross-border recognition of adoptions

jeu, 02/02/2017 - 12:01
Plenary sessions : To protect adopted children’s best interests, MEPs have urged the EU Commission to require all EU countries to recognise each other’s adoption certificates automatically. Their resolution, voted on Thursday, proposes a European Certificate of Adoption to speed up the automatic recognition process.
